Definition ∞ Open Interest Neutrality describes a state in derivatives markets where the total value of open long positions is approximately equivalent to the total value of open short positions. This condition indicates a balanced market sentiment. It suggests an equilibrium between bullish and bearish speculation.
Context ∞ Open interest neutrality is a market indicator frequently discussed in crypto news, signifying a relatively balanced speculative environment in futures and options markets. Deviations from this neutrality can signal the potential for significant price movements as one side of the market gains dominance. This makes it a key metric for understanding market positioning.
